Birds and Bodacious Botanicals New Works by Cindy Taylor
I am a retired teacher living in Mineral Point, Wisconsin where I now have free time to pursue my enjoyment of painting. I studied art at UW-Milwaukee, where I graduated with a BFA in painting and drawing. I have exhibited my paintings in galleries in Mineral Point and Milwaukee, and most recently at the Gallery of Wisconsin Art (GOWA) in West Bend, Wi.
Over the years I have been inspired by many subjects, but I would say that a common thread in all of my paintings has been a strong interest in color and pattern, which continues in my current paintings on a much more fanciful and abstract level. I like to describe them as: “botanical landscapes containing organic forms growing wildly in a vast array of complex configurations and colors, sometimes with birds added, just for fun.”
